Warehouse Associate - Medical Waste

ManagementFull-time

About the role

The Plant Associate is responsible for unloading waste from vehicles, decontaminating vehicles, and staging waste for processing using conveyor systems and the Biotrack system for accurate recordkeeping.

Responsibilities

  • Sort waste materials for processing
  • Operate autoclaves and incinerators
  • Manage reusable containers
  • Ensure proper decontamination and housekeeping standards
  • Maintain accurate recordkeeping using the Biotrack system
  • Adhere to safety protocols and communicate effectively
  • Perform physical tasks including standing, lifting, pushing, and pulling
  • Work in diverse environments, both inside and outside

Requirements

  • Safety awareness and compliance
  • Effective communication skills
  • Physical ability to stand, lift, push, pull, and work in varied environments
  • Potential drug testing and safety compliance for employment

Qualifications

Preferred qualifications include at least one year of experience in a plant setting and a valid driver’s license.
